Collaborative Filtering via Rating Concentration

This is the software used in the paper 
"Collaborative Filtering via Rating Concentration"
by Bert Huang and Tony Jebara.

See demo.m to see how the software is called. The mex files are compiled
for 64-bit Mac OS X, and if you are on a different platform, you should call
makeMex.m to compile my mex files and follow the instructions inside
the lbfgs-for-matlab directory to compile lbfgs on your platform 
(or http://www.mathworks.com/matlabcentral/fileexchange/authors/28250).
This will require a fortran compiler and probably a lot of frustration.
Alternatively, you can edit the line of code in (86) maxentmulti.m that
calls lbfgs and replace it with your favorite nonlinear optimizer. 

The demo runs on a 50/50 split of the movielens million data set 
(movielens.org).
